Transaction d21f6b2897378e215a96c183cd6d0f445c4e7253e976cc457a8029e89a423139
2 Input
2 Outputs
- d21f6b2897378e215a96c183cd6d0f445c4e7253e976cc457a8029e89a423139:0
- d21f6b2897378e215a96c183cd6d0f445c4e7253e976cc457a8029e89a423139:1
value 200100000
address 2N5VYRx2TDC9vRz7LghFZ267kUg3biCyRHy
value 1088159
address ms73PdvatQi2PerJufgCd24UmzNg8DySTp